What are Demister Pads and Ammonia Valves?

Posted by LNT Industrial Engineering Services on December 6th, 2019

As the name suggests, a demister pad helps in the removal of mist from the gaseous phase. Entrainment is a commonly encountered problem in the process of separation of liquid and gas. Entrainment generally entails gases and vapors carrying over a particulate matter that can affect the quality and purity of the substance. 

A good solution to this issue is to invest in a demister pad. It is a device that can separate entrained liquid droplets from the gas or vapor that you are trying to separate and purify. More and more industries dealing with gas separation have been seeking out demister pad suppliers for a wide range of reasons. But what exactly is a demister pad?

Demister pads can be a mesh type coalescer that can separate mist from gas by its aggregation until it is heavy enough to change state to liquid droplets. When good demister pad manufacturers are employed, droplets can be removed down to 5 microns or lower while keeping the free volume of maximum 99% and a surface area up to 1940 square meter per cubic meter. This high value of free volume makes the pressure drop across the pad sufficiently low and even negligible in certain applications. The efficiency can be up to 99.9% due to the minimum pressure drop.

Ammonia valves are also manufactured according to the set industry standards to suit the many industrial refrigeration requirements. They are available in straight and angle designs as well as in butt weld, socket weld, or threaded connections.

These valves are designed with the highest quality materials. This makes it easy to dismantle and open in the case of repairs. The design lends flow properties that are quite favorable in industrial refrigeration. The valve is housed in cold-resistant steel to withstand low-temperature processes. The spindle is made from polished stainless steel that is suitable for O-ring sealing. The packing gland ensures the optimum tightness in the range of temperature and pressures the processes are performed at.

Ammonia valves manufacturers take care to include the following salient features in the valves they design.

  • The valves can be used with most common refrigerants, including R717 and non-corrosive refrigerants. Thus they are compatible with most industrial needs.
  • The valves are receptive to flow in both directions.
  • The valves are available in straight and angled versions.
  • The pressure range is 29 bar G.
  • The temperature range is -60°C to 150°C.
  • The valves are built to last, reliable, and resistant to corrosion.
